Bandai Namco Entertainment Asia has officially announced that Captain Tsubasa 2: World Fighters is set to release in 2026 on PS5, Nintendo Switch, Xbox Series, and PC via Steam.
The highly anticipated sequel to the beloved soccer action game promises larger teams, more characters, and enhanced gameplay mechanics.
The debut trailer showcases the thrill of soccer battles with 22 national teams, over 110 playable characters, and more than 150 unique animated special moves. Fans can expect challengers from around the world, including new teams and original characters, clashing in meticulously animated matches that capture the excitement of the iconic series.
Captain Tsubasa 2: World Fighters – Enhanced Gameplay & Super Moves
World Fighters invites players to create their own character and join Tsubasa on his journey. Along the way, they’ll forge friendships, face rivals, and aim to bring the trophy home.
Action on the field has been significantly upgraded. New super moves amplify every aspect of play — from passing and dribbling to tackling and blocking. A new tactical system pits goalkeeper against shooter, letting players experience jaw-dropping duels of super shots and counters inspired by the original anime and manga.
